What Not to Do

A note to other aspiring eHow writers out there: don't miss the "Suggested Articles" postings. You can come up with how-to articles on your own, but the eHow editors come up with topics they need articles on, and post 50-100 a week. I try to snap these up because they get more views and earn you more "points." I'm not really sure how points work, but the more I get the more money I seem to make, so I'll play along.

I can't figure out if they submit a new batch on Mondays or Tuesdays, but I missed it this week and wrote a grand total of two Suggested Articles. I'm pretty disappointed because after the 27 article marathon last week, my earnings have been steadily increasing. Now I guess I have to rely on my own brain for article ideas.
